Location: Kaukauna, WI
Payrate range: $16.00-19.00 an hour
Shift: 1st (6:00AM - 4:30PM, Monday - Thursday, 10 hours)
Job description: Prepare and handle material item to be prepped and assembled for positioners.
Summary Of Major Responsibilities/Duties:
- At the beginning and end of shift, walk the yard and make a list of what is available for the shop to work on
- Follow the list provided by the supervisor as to what need to worked on and in what order it needs to be done
- Use sound judgement and forward thinking when the work schedule changes.
- Prep all wagons for the blasters and painters, staying ahead of them so work continues to flow steadily
- Working directly with positioner department when wagons and trailer need to go directly to them
- Assemble paperwork packet for each wagon, pull prints and double check they are tracked properly
- Pull shop wagons back to the appropriate bay
- Prepping subassemblies for positioner (gearboxes, hydraulic cylingers, air headers, power cord, air pumps, ext.)
- Building/Wiring new foot pedals (electrical experience in not required, on the job training will be provided)
- Run the reclaim system 1-2 times a day depending on workflow
- Inspects wagons/trailers to ensure safety and proper loading for painters.
- Maintain organization of prints and paperwork in order and separated
- Apprise supervisor when issues arise
- Blow/shovel snow off wagons and trailers before bringing them into the building
- Assembly of Positioners
- Delivery and pickup of parts
- Repairing gripper jaws.
- Conducts work safely and follows all safety procedures. Rejects work that is not safe and discusses the situation with supervisor.
- Other duties as assigned.
